Dele Alli has revealed he has a World Cup reminder that goes off on his phone at the same time every day.

Since joining Everton two years ago from Tottenham Hotspur, Alli’s career has been hampered by multiple injury problems and a big drop in form.

Last season, he spent time on loan at Turkish Super Lig side Besiktas but failed to make an impact.

Alli is currently recovering from injury and with his Everton contract set to expire at the end of the 23/24 campaign, the 28-year-old spoke about his main goal for the future.

He said: “I spoke about it in my interview and don't want to go over it too much again – but I know my level as a player and what I can get to.

“I know how good I can be when my head is in the right place and I'm feeling good. Obviously I'm disappointed with the injury right now but I'm excited to get playing.

“It's hard for me to even watch football. It's been tough for me, I'd say, this past eight months has been hard to watch.”

Alli added: “You know you can set reminders on your phone, I have a reminder at 11 o'clock every day that says, ‘World Cup 2026’. That's my aim for now. I think that people will be like, ‘he hasn't played in a year’ but I don't care, I know my level.

“The only target I have is the World Cup right now. Obviously I'm injured and contracted to Everton and so my mind is just about taking it day by day and making sure my injury is healed and that I'm in the best possible condition after the summer.

“It's annoying because I'll be just fully training as the season ends so it means that I won't have to rush it.”

Despite his contract running out in the summer, Alli is determined to resume his playing career in the Premier League.

He said: “I'm signed to Everton so I think it'd be disrespectful to say anything else while I'm here. They've been so amazing with me and I don't know if it's off the cards being there next season so I won't talk about any of that because they've been amazing and I don't know the details of the situation but I want to stay in the Premier League and be at the highest level and playing against the best players.

“It's exciting. Some players might panic and think, ‘I’m out of contract in the summer’ but this is a great opportunity to show myself and show what an amazing story it has been and what it's going to continue to be.”
